For more than 50 years, EDC has advocated for the well being and wellness of young children by way of its lengthy-standing programmatic support of the federal Head Start program. This legacy continues with EDC’s work on the National Center on Early Childhood Health and Wellness, certainly one of 9 federal centers advancing finest practices for linking well being and early childhood education systems, well being professionals, and families. In 1964, ESI received Education funding from the Carnegie Corporation of New York to handle the high fee of college dropout amongst African American students. In response, EDC established pre-school centers at six Historically Black Colleges and Universities to extend opportunities for low-revenue college students. The method was later scaled as much as become the model of the federal government’s Upward Bound program. In 1968, ESI merged with the Institute for Educational Innovation to type EDC.
